Etymology[edit]
super- + rationality, coined by Douglas Hofstadter.
Noun[edit]
superrationality (uncountable)
- A kind of rational decision-making, different from the widely-accepted game-theoretical one. A player whose opponent is also superrational will cooperate in the Prisoner's dilemma problem, whereas a game-theoretically rational player will defect.
